"in 1999 Baker walked out of Talk Radio after station management wanted to move his show to a Saturday morning"

Actually, Baker had already been presenting a lunchtime show as well as his evening programme for about a year for the station but at the start of 1999 moved to a four hour slot starting at 8am on Saturdays which lasted two weeks before he was sacked supposedly for not talking about football enough (something they'd not previously been that bothered about, if anyone remembers those shows) News piece: http://www.guardian.co.uk/uk_news/story/0,,323823,00.html
